matlab解方程組顯示錶達式不顯示結果

時間 2021-10-30 05:53:29

1樓:匿名使用者

l1=26.5;

l2=105.6;

l3=67.5;

l4=87.5;

l5=34.4;

l6=25.0;

theta1=3.14/6;

syms theta3

t1=l2*l2-l4*l4-l1*l1+l3*l3+2*l1*l4*cos(theta1)

t2=-2*l3*l1+2*l3*l4

t3=2*l1*l3*sin(theta1)s=solve(cos(theta3)*t2-t3*sin(theta3)-t1,theta3)

vpa(s)

2樓:考運旺查卯

你的程式已經求出來y_e的表示式了。注意:有兩個表示式,因為方程有兩個解。

後面要做的是對其求導,用diff命令,然後繪圖,當然用plot。

下面程式完成了你要的功能。

t=0:0.0001:0.07;

[x_c,y_c,y_e]=solve('(x_c-200*cos(100*t))^2+(y_c-200*sin(100*t))^2=500^2','(x_c-750)^2+(y_c-350)^2=800^2','y_e=350*(x_c-350)/750+350');

dy_e=diff(y_e);

plot(t,subs(dy_e))

最後畫出來的圖有兩條線,分別是兩個y_e表示式對t的導數。

matlab solve解顯示root(一個方程),怎麼顯示出數值解??

3樓:嚕嚕晗寶

當solve解顯示有root形式的方程解,可以用vpa()函式命令求出方程的數值解。具體操作過程為

>> syms x

>> s=solve(det([5*x 2 1;-1 4*x 2;2 -3 10*x])==0,x)

>> s=vpa(s)

從運算結果,可以看到方程的實數解為-0.21474642157167318650910503113932

4樓:nexus科技

請參考以下matlab**。注意應用solve()函式的格式。例如solve(f(x)=0,x)可以簡寫成以下形式:solve(f(x))

執行如下matlab**:

% ***************===

syms x;

solve(det([5*x 2 1; -1 4*x 2; 2 -3 10*x]))

eval(ans)

%********************執行結果如下:

ans =

-0.2147

0.1074 + 0.4946i

0.1074 - 0.4946i

5樓:真

clear;clc;

syms x

solve(det([5*x 2 1;-1 4*x 2;2  -3 10*x])==0,x)

a=solve(det([5*x 2 1;-1 4*x 2;2  -3 10*x])==0,x, 'maxdegree', 3)

vpa(a)

double(a)

6樓:匿名使用者

用變數精度演算法(vpa)現在顯示的一個方程的根,比如

matlab 符號方程結果怎麼變成數值?

7樓:屈國慶四川巴中

在你的語言後面加上一句

eval(h);

就可以了,效果見下圖

8樓:mcr董事長

h=solve('1+a*x+b*x^2+c*x^3=0');

a=1;

b=2;

c=3;

eval(h)

ans =

-0.7839

0.0586 + 0.6495i

0.0586 - 0.6495i

或者>> subs(h)

ans =

-0.7839

0.0586 + 0.6495i

0.0586 - 0.6495i

9樓:轉基因牛

a=a(1);

b=a(2);

c=a(3);

syms x;

d = 1+a*x+b*x^2+c*x^3;

h=solve(d)

解方程組(要過程)解方程組要過程,速度

解 全部相加得 6a 6b 6c 6d 24 所以。a b c d 4.將原方程第一式與 式相減得 2a 3所以a 3 2 將原方程第二式與 式相減得 2b 5所以b 5 2 將原方程第三式與 式相減得 2c 5所以c 5 2 將原方程第四式與 式相減得 2d 1所以d 1 2 所以。a 3 2,b...

matlab符號表示式求值,用matlab語句編寫一個程式,要求 輸入一個字串後顯示一個數字。

京基 互相關函式給出了在頻域內兩個訊號是否相關的一個判斷指標,把兩測點之間訊號的互譜與各自的自譜聯絡了起來。它能用來確定輸出訊號有多大程度來自輸入訊號,對修正測量中接入噪聲源而產生的誤差非常有效. 有時候需要解符號表示式得到某個量關於其他量的顯式表示式,matlab解出的結果任然是符號表示式,我們希...

圓錐面方程表示式,圓錐的函式表示式是什麼?

xy yz zx 0,或xy yz zx 0,或xy yz zx 0,或xy yz zx 0 以 0.0.0 為圓錐面頂點 1.0.0 0.1.0 0.0.1 在圓錐上,由三點決定的平面x y z 1與球面x 2 y 2 z 2 1的交線l是圓錐面準線。設點p x,y,z 是圓錐面上的點,u,v,w...